After 14 years, Top Dog’s Oakland location is expected to close in the next few weeks, co-owner Renie Riemann told SFGATE. This would leave the popular hot dog spot beloved by UC Berkeley students with just one remaining location — the original on Durant Avenue.
Riemann, who opened the first Top Dog with her husband Richard Riemann in 1966, said that they decided not to renew their lease at the Oakland shop at 3272 Lakeshore Ave. following a string of recent robberies; they have been renting month-to-month ever since. Financially, they weren’t sure if they could keep the business going. However, she said that business has turned around since then and that they had resolved to stay. So when the Lakeshore Avenue building was sold, they thought the new owner would offer them a new lease — but that didn’t happen, she said.
“In a nutshell, they’re putting in who they want to put in and evicting us,” Riemann said. “It’s really painful. It’s my favorite place.”…
